Method and jet nozzle for scattering droplets in a gas stream

In the method for interspersing a gas flow ( 8 ) with fluid droplets ( 5 ), the fluid droplets ( 5 ) are injected in a fluid injection plane into the gas flow ( 8 ), characterised in that an auxiliary gas ( 6.1, 6.2 ) is simultaneously injected with the fluid droplets ( 5 ) into the gas flow ( 8 ). The injection speed of the auxiliary gas ( 6.1, 6.2 ) is larger than the injection speed of the fluid droplets ( 5 ) so that the injected auxiliary gas ( 6.1, 6.2 ) stabilises the injected fluid droplets ( 5 ) with respect to trajectory and size, partly shields them from the gas flow ( 8 ) and/or entrains them into the gas flow ( 8 ). By way of this one achieves an improved control of the spatial distribution of the fluid droplets ( 5 ) and their size distribution. The fluid droplets ( 5 ) penetrate the gas flow ( 8 ) more efficiently than without an auxiliary gas ( 6.1, 6.2 ). A preferred use is the online wet-cleaning of a gas turbine compressor.
